With the growing acknowledgment of adult ADHD, online testing alternatives have ended up being increasingly popular. An online ADHD test can be an effective initial step to examine whether one need to pursue a more extensive evaluation with a health care professional.
How Do Online ADHD Tests Work?Questionnaires: Most online tests consist of a series of questions designed to help recognize prospective symptoms of ADHD based on self-reported experiences.Scoring: After completing the survey, users get a score showing the probability of having ADHD.Recommendations: The results often come with recommendations for next actions, which might include seeking advice from a psychologist or psychiatrist for an official diagnosis.Table 2: Types of Online ADHD TestsTest For ADHD TypeDescriptionEase of accessSelf-Assessment QuizzesSeries of concerns examining symptomsFree ADHD Test Online/Paid optionsSymptom ChecklistsLists of ADHD symptoms to evaluate personal experienceFree ADHD Online Test choicesStructured ScreeningMore formalized tests consisting of diagnostic criteriaUsually paidBenefits of Online Testing for ADHDAvailability: Individuals can take these tests from the comfort of their own homes, making it simpler to seek aid.Anonymity: Online tools supply a personal and discreet method for adults to explore their symptoms.Immediate results: Unlike conventional testing, online evaluations frequently provide instant feedback.Affordable: Many online tests are free or low-cost compared to in-person assessments.Limitations of Online ADHD Tests
Despite their benefits, online ADHD tests should not replace professional diagnosis and treatment. Limitations include:
Accuracy: Online tests might yield incorrect positives or negatives, causing misdiagnosis.Lack of Comprehensive Evaluation: A proper assessment often consists of scientific interviews, physical tests, and perhaps input from relative.Self-report Bias: The accuracy of outcomes may depend heavily on the individual's self-awareness and honesty.Next Steps After an Online Test
If a private completes an online ADHD test and gets signs of possible ADHD, the following steps are advised:
Consult a Professional: Schedule an appointment with a psychologist or psychiatrist who concentrates on ADHD.Total a Clinical Evaluation: Be prepared to take part in a thorough assessment, which may consist of additional questionnaires and interviews.Explore Treatment Options: If detected, go over treatment choices, including therapy, medication, and way of life adjustments.FAQs About ADHD in Adults and Online Testing1. Can online tests accurately diagnose ADHD?
No, online tests are not diagnostic tools but can suggest whether professional assessment is required.
2. Exist age limitations for taking online tests?
Most online tests are designed for adults however might appropriate for older teens. It's important to inspect test specs.
3. How long does it require to complete an online ADHD test?
Typically, online ADHD tests take anywhere from 10-30 minutes to complete, depending on the variety of questions.
4. What should I do if my online test suggests high ADHD threat?
Look for an expert examination to talk about the results and check out prospective treatment options.
5. Exist reliable online ADHD tests?
Numerous trusted mental health organizations use online assessments. Always research before taking an online test to ensure its credibility.
